About 14 Collingwood Crescent

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

14 Collingwood Crescent is a five-bedroom detached house in Ponteland, Newcastle Upon Tyne, Newcastle Upon Tyne (NE20 9DZ). It has a recorded floor area of 164 m² (around 1765 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(January 2017)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79). The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.

2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used, 1 pending.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. An application is currently awaiting a decision. On the market in August 2017 and unlisted since — roughly 9 years. Today's modelled estimate of £655,000 is 33.7% above the 2017 sale price.
